Toro 24-inch 66-7960 Drift Breaker Kit Specification

The Toro 24-inch 66-7960 Drift Breaker Kit is specifically designed to enhance the performance of Toro snow blowers by effectively managing and breaking through heavy snow drifts. This kit is engineered for seamless integration with compatible Toro models, ensuring optimal efficiency and ease of use. Manufactured from durable materials, it is built to withstand harsh winter conditions, providing long-lasting reliability and durability. The kit includes components that are easy to install, allowing users to quickly equip their snow blower with enhanced drift-breaking capabilities. Once installed, the drift breaker enhances the snow blower's ability to cut through deep and compacted snow, reducing the need for multiple passes and improving overall clearing efficiency. The design of the drift breaker also helps in channeling snow away from the blower's intake, minimizing clogging and maintaining consistent performance. Toro 24-inch 66-7960 Drift Breaker Kit F.A.Q.

How do I install the Toro 24-inch 66-7960 Drift Breaker Kit on my snow blower?

To install the drift breaker kit, first, secure the brackets to the sides of the snow blower housing. Then attach the drift breaker arms to the brackets using the provided bolts and nuts. Ensure all components are tightly fastened.

What tools are required for installing the Toro drift breaker kit?

You will need a socket wrench set, a screwdriver, and a pair of pliers to install the drift breaker kit.

What maintenance is required for the drift breaker kit?

Regularly check for any loose bolts or signs of wear. Clean the kit after use to prevent rust and ensure it operates smoothly.

How do I troubleshoot if the drift breaker kit is not performing well?

First, check if all components are securely fastened. Inspect for any damage or wear. If issues persist, consult the manual or contact Toro support for further assistance.

Is it possible to adjust the height of the drift breaker kit?

Yes, the height can be adjusted by repositioning the mounting brackets on the snow blower housing to better suit your snow conditions.
